Description
Make teaching geometry fun with this 5th grade hands-on math unit! This 5th grade math unit covers classifying polygons, triangles, and quadarilaterals. Standards 5.G.3 and 5.G.4 are covered. Your students will learn about
- classifying polygons into different categories based on the number of sides they have.
- They’ll learn to classify triangles and quadrilaterals based on their different attributes.
- They will also learn to justify statements about polygons.
What’s included in this 5th grade geometry unit:
- Unit overview that shows which lesson is being taught each day
- Vocabulary and Definition Cards that help your students learn new vocabulary and incorporate it into their math conversations
- Questioning Cards to guide your lesson and group conversations
- Printables including posters, templates, manipulatives, and other tools to support your instruction
- 1 week of classifying polygons, triangles, and quadrilaterals lesson plans that are teacher and student-friendly and are fully editable so you can adjust them to meet the needs of your students
- Problem of the Day in four different formats!
- Daily worksheets that are a quick check of the lesson taught each day. Each day 5 practice page is a review of the objectives covered during the week and can be used as formative assessment.
- Daily center activities that provide fun and engaging extra practice
- Additional resources including extra games, interactive notebooks and other resources to support instruction
- Pre and Post Assessments for the unit that use similar problems so you can directly gauge student growth
- Answer keys for the assessments and practice pages to save you precious time!

This is the seventh unit of 5th Grade Guided Math. This unit is focused on Classifying Figures (5.G.3-4) (TEKS 5.5–download the preview for more information about TEKS correlation) and is a one week long unit.
5th Grade Guided Math units are recommended for small group, targeted instruction, but also can be used in a whole group format.
There are two separate PDF’s included. One with CC Standards and one with TEKS standards.
